Assessing Lawyer Experience



When picking a criminal defense attorney, evaluating their experience is critical. You'll wish to dive deep right into their past cases to comprehend not simply the quantity of situations they've handled, however the top quality of results accomplished.

It's not practically for how long they have actually been practicing, yet exactly how well they have actually dealt with cases similar to yours. Look for specifics: Have they dealt with costs like yours prior to? The amount of of those instances mosted likely to trial, and what were the results?

It's crucial you know they have actually obtained a solid track record with effective results in situations similar to what you're encountering. Experience in a court room is specifically vital if your case mosts likely to test. You do not just desire someone who knows the law; you need somebody who maneuvers effectively within the court room dynamics.

Additionally, check where they have actually gotten their experience. Somebody who's familiar with the local courts and judges can be helpful. They'll comprehend local procedures and nuances which can play an important function in the protection technique.

Choosing somebody experienced can make all the distinction. Guarantee their experience lines up very closely with your requirements, giving you the best shot at a favorable result.

Reviewing Communication Abilities



Reviewing interaction skills is important when selecting a criminal defense lawyer. You'll desire somebody who not just speaks clearly yet likewise pays attention properly. Your lawyer ought to make you really feel comprehended and ensure that you grasp every facet of your situation.

Try to find a legal representative that can clarify intricate lawful terms in simple language. They should be friendly, making it very easy for you to ask inquiries and express worries. Notice how they interact during your preliminary appointment. Are they client? Do they offer in-depth answers or thrill via explanations?

Excellent communication also indicates staying in contact. Your lawyer needs to upgrade you regularly regarding your situation's progression. Inspect if they favor e-mails, call, or in person meetings and see if their recommended technique straightens with your requirements.

Finally, consider their capacity to communicate under pressure. Courtroom settings are high-stress atmospheres, and you need somebody who can verbalize your protection clearly and well in front of a discretionary.

Ask for instances of exactly how they've taken care of difficult situations or situations in the past.

First of please click the next website page , if there's an absence of proof, your lawyer may argue that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your job to verify innocence; it's the district attorney's work to verify shame beyond an affordable doubt. If they can't, you must be acquitted.


One more common method is self-defense, specifically in cases including charges like assault or homicide. If you were shielding yourself, your lawyer could utilize this strategy to validate your actions lawfully. This needs verifying that your assumption of hazard was reasonable which your feedback was proportionate to that threat.

In some cases, your protection may include doubting the legitimacy of how evidence was acquired. If police violated your legal rights during the examination, proof could be reduced, which can significantly damage the prosecution's case.

Finally, your lawyer might discuss an appeal bargain if it serves your best interest. This typically takes place if the evidence against you is strong however there are minimizing aspects that can result in minimized costs or sentencing.
